What is a settlement deal for mesothelioma?

A mesothelioma contract is a legal contract that is made between an asbestos firm and the victims who were exposed to asbestos. The compensation from these lawsuits helps victims and their families pay for mesothelioma lawyer treatment, lost income as well as pain and suffering and other expenses. Mesothelioma settlements can be reached prior to or during the trial. However, fewer than 5% of mesothelioma lawsuits go to trial.

The amount of money a person receives for mesothelioma varies based on several factors. The type of asbestos products a person was exposed to as well as their age and health history, and the severity of their condition will all affect the amount they receive. Compensation is also different according to state. Certain states limit the amount of compensation individuals are able to receive. Some states do not.

The amount of money you receive will also depend on the nature and amount of the damages you claim. Economic damages could include past and future medical costs as well as lost wages and travel expenses. Non-economic damages include physical and mental suffering, loss in enjoyment of life, and loss of consortium.

Asbestos victims should work with a top mesothelioma law firm to ensure they receive the highest possible settlement. A lawyer will assist victims understand all of their legal options and make the best claim. They will keep track of the amount of losses and expenses and establish the time and date of exposure.

How long will it take to settle a mesothelioma-related case?

The time needed to reach a mesothelioma settlement can vary widely based on the specific circumstances of each case. Certain settlements can be concluded quickly, whereas others could take years to settle. During the settlement, the parties will negotiate the amount of compensation to be paid to each victim. This compensation will include a variety of damages like medical costs loss of wages, emotional stress.

Generally speaking the more asbestos exposure an individual has experienced, the larger their mesothelioma settlement will be. Other factors can also affect the value of a settlement. Many victims were exposed to asbestos settlement at sites involving lots of manual work. It's therefore more difficult to obtain significant compensation in these cases.

The number of defendants may influence the time required to reach a settlement. Often, mesothelioma cases have multiple defendants that must be reached in order to receive a fair amount of compensation a victim. This makes the negotiation process more complicated, which in turn can prolong the time required to settle.
